One thing that i learnt from there is that there are 2 kinds of teachings in life: 1-Survival, 2-Success. I guess most of us, actually effectively all of us have been trained only to SURVIVE in this society and nothing more...and true enough, we spend the rest of our lives applying that technique. And at the end of the day? We are stuck with this skill, and if there're any changes to the way things are, we die! (not literally lah)

They say give a man a fish and it will feed him for a day, but teach a man to fish and it will feed him for life. But wat if one day he becomes too sick or old to fish? Who'll feed him? NOBODY!!

For me, I'd want to teach all my family and friends to fish too so that they can also survive on their own. But if for some reason i can't continue fishin, will anyone feed me? I'm most certain...YES! =)
